The type of defoamer that is used will depend on the specific application. For example, defoamers that are used in food processing must be food-grade and non-toxic.
Defoamers are an important part of many industrial processes. They help to prevent foam formation and control foam that has already formed. This can improve productivity, safety, and product quality.
